About Steven Blotner

Steven Blotner is a scholar working on Oncology, Infectious Diseases, Ophthalmology, Molecular Biology and Hematology, having authored 36 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HIV/AIDS drug development and treatment (8 papers), Cancer-related Molecular Pathways (7 papers), Retinal Diseases and Treatments (6 papers),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(5 papers), Hepatitis C virus research (4 papers), HER2/EGFR in Cancer Research (3 papers),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(3 papers) and DNA Repair Mechanisms (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Oncology (508 citations), Hepatology (134 citations), Cancer Research (145 citations), Hematology (98 citations) and Pathology and Forensic Medicine (129 citations). Steven Blotner has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Vaikunth Cuchelkar, Katja Schulze, Funda Meric‐Bernstam, Howard A. Burris, Ron Bose, John D. Hainsworth, David R. Spigel, Christopher J. Sweeney, Charles Swanton and Razelle Kurzrock.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Blood, Cancer Chemotherapy and Pharmacology, Investigational New Drugs and Journal of Hepatology.
